Senior IT Business Analyst, IT – Channels (POS GI)
Job Purpose As a business analyst, this candidate is responsible for gathering users' requirements for system enhancements, analysis of requirements, plan and execute functional, non-functional and system integration tests.
The Job - Act as the subject-matter-expert (SME) & main liason between General Insurance business stakeholders & technical team.
- Work with business stakeholders to document requirements, rules, processes, constraints, etc
- Analyse business requirements, rules, processes, constraints, etc & translate these into artifacts usable by technical team to perform system development, enhancements &bug fixing activities.
- Review design with the technical team & verify the suitability of proposed solutions to meet business requirements.
- Make recommendations to business stakeholders in situations where workarounds are required or business requirements cannot be met directly & fully.
- Prioritise activities & deliverables with business stakeholders , Project Manager & technical team.
- Review high level and detailed test plans/test cases for System Integration Tests (SIT) and User Acceptance Tests (UAT)
- Participate in one or more concurrent activities (Projects & Business-As-Usual)
- Prepare, review & update system documentation and specifications.
- Manage requirements traceability matrix and track requirements status throughout the system delivery period.
- Perform test & health-checks before releasing systems to business stakeholders.
- Provide support to ensure smooth day-to-day system operations.
- Manage exceptions proactively to ensure quick recoveries.
- Takes accountability in considering business and regulatory compliance risks and takes appropriate steps to mitigate the risks.
- Maintains awareness of industry trends on regulatory compliance, emerging threats and technologies in order to understand the risk and better safeguard the company.
- Highlights any potential concerns /risks and proactively shares best risk management practices.